A bioassay is an analytical method to determine the concentration or potency of a substance by its effect on living animals or plants (in vivo), or on living cells or tissues(in vitro). A bioassay can be either quantal or quantitative, direct or indirect. If the measured response is binary, the assay is quantal, if not, it is quantitative. WebAbstract. Biosensor technology enabled the specific detection of diverse biomolecules including pathogenic microorganisms in a rapid, sensitive, easy, and cheap manner in recent years. Emerging technologies like nanotechnology, lab-on-a-chip microdevices, etc., lead further development to obtain biosensors with much better performance.
